AEG MM-PMC2-300
Product Introduction:
The AEG MM-PMC2-300 is a high-end programmable motion controller from the Modicon PMC2 product family, specifically configured for 3-axis coordinated motion control. It is designed for complex multi-axis applications including CNC machining, robotics, flying shear, and synchronized conveyor systems. The controller integrates motion control, PLC logic, and I/O handling in a single platform, eliminating the need for separate motion controllers and PLCs.

Working Principle:
The MM-PMC2-300 executes motion control programs stored in its Flash memory. The motion control engine runs on a dedicated DSP processor at a fixed 1 ms cycle, calculating trajectory setpoints for each axis using interpolation algorithms (linear, circular, cubic). The computed position setpoints are sent to servo drives via high-speed pulse output or analog command. Simultaneously, the PLC logic processor handles discrete and analog I/O, executing the application program. Both processors share data through a dual-port RAM interface, enabling tight coordination between motion and logic.
